Enjoy apartment living at the Cube – Live within a 3 or 5-bedroom self-catered apartment with other students, or enjoy independent living in one of our 18 single occupancy studio units. Our Wellington halls are self-catered, however you can purchase a meal package for the Tussock cafe if you prefer to have your meals provided.
Socialise and relax in the Cube's common room and recreation room with a pool table, TV and sofas. Internet and wifi is available in all rooms and common areas.
The Cube is just a short walk to Massey University’s Wellington campus, the city centre, public transport links and the Massey gym.
We do our best to provide for your preference of single gender, mixed gender and rainbow communities within our apartments. Accessible accommodations are available for students with accessibility requirements.

Apartments
Enjoy both independence and social living in our shared apartments. There are 3 to 5 bedrooms in each apartment – rooms are approximately 8 square metres and include:
- Double bed – rest comfortably on a spacious double bed, complete with a mattress and mattress protector for a good night's sleep. Studios are single-occupancy only.
- Study area – study from the comfort of your own room. Your room includes a designated study desk and chair.
- Shelf, pinboard and wardrobe – you will have plenty of storage space for your clothes, books, and personal items.
- Heater – for a cozy and comfortable living environment year-round.
- Privacy and security – all apartments, including each bedroom, have secure lockable main doors and opening windows fitted with security stays.
Studio units
The Cube’s studio apartments are modern and spacious, with open plan living and separate bathroom with shower. Here's what you can expect in each fully furnished room:
- Double bed – rest comfortably on a spacious double bed, complete with a mattress and mattress protector for a good night's sleep. Studios are single-occupancy only.
- Ensuite bathroom with shower
- Kitchenette – including stove top, oven, mini fridge, sink, kitchenware, utensils and crockery.
- Study area – study from the comfort of your own room. Your room includes a designated study desk, chair, and desk light.
- Shelf, pinboard and wardrobe – you will have plenty of storage space for your clothes, books, and personal items.
- Living area – relax in your down time with a 2-seater sofa and TV table.
- Heater – for a cozy and comfortable living environment year-round.
- Privacy and security – enjoy peace of mind with a lockable door and privacy screens.

Car parking and bike storage
Car parking and bike storage
Unfortunately, there is no car parking at the Cube, however students can apply for a semester permit at a cost of $120.00 per semester.
With a valid permit, you can park in:
- Massey Entrance D car park
- Massey King Street car parks
- Any Massey car park after 6pm and anytime on weekends.
If you hold an active permit, you do not need to pay for hourly parking. Please ensure you display your Massey Student Dash Pass at all times.
To apply for a permit, please email:
Care Park will review your application and your vehicle will be registered for use in the designated car parks once payment is confirmed.
For those who prefer biking, bicycles can be stored in the Cube Bike Shed for $25.
Room allocation
Room allocation
Massey halls are designed to provide a supportive transition environment for students who may be leaving home, moving away from their support networks, or arriving in a new city or country for the first time.
When allocating accommodation, we consider a range of factors including your home location, age, transition and wellbeing support needs, study requirements, and our ability to create a balanced and supportive residential community.
If you are not immediately offered a room, you may be placed on a waitlist and will be contacted if a suitable space becomes available.

Room rates and payment options
Our payment options are flexible to suit your financial preferences. You can pay your Accommodation Fees by semester or for the full year, and domestic students can pay weekly. You need to pay a deposit in addition to your Accommodation Fees.
2027 pricing and payment options
2027 pricing and payment options
| Room type | Week | Full year* | Semester 1* | Semester 2* |
|---|---|---|---|---|
|
Shared Apartment (3 & 5 bedroom) |
$338 | $14,196 | $6,422 | $7,436 |
|
Studio Unit |
$445 | $18,690 | $8,455 | $9,790 |
*excludes deposit
Payment options
- Full pre-payment – Pay your entire accommodation fees in one payment, either by semester or for the full year.
- Semester payments – Pay your accommodation fees in two instalments, one prior to the start of each semester.
- Weekly payments (domestic students only) – Domestic students may choose to pay via direct debit, with an advance payment followed by weekly instalments.
Deposit
Deposit
When your application for accommodation is successful, you will receive an official offer. To secure your place in the halls, you must:
- Pay the required deposit
- Complete and return the Residential Agreement.
Both must be completed by the offer expiry date stated in your offer letter.
Please note: this deposit is in addition to your Accommodation Fees.
| Deposit break down | Full year | Semester |
|---|---|---|
| Administration Fee | $150 | $150 |
|
Bond (refundable when contract ends if no damage or arrears) |
$500 | $500 |
| Activity fee | $150 | $100 |
| Mattress protector | $30 | $30 |
| Total | $830 | $780 |

Information for international students
You must be over 18 years old to stay in Massey Halls as an international student. Arrival Day for international students is 1 week before classes start.
Massey does not offer a pick-up service from Wellington airport, however there are several public transport options available to you.
Early arrival in New Zealand
Early arrival in New Zealand
Arrival Day is designed to support students with their transition into halls life, including meeting other residents, connecting with support staff, participating in orientation activities, and settling into the community together. Arriving significantly earlier can impact a student’s ability to build connections and fully experience this transition.
As part of our commitment to the Education (Pastoral Care of Tertiary and International Learners) Code of Practice, we aim to ensure students arrive at an environment where appropriate wellbeing, support, and community systems are fully in place.
If you require an early arrival due to exceptional circumstances, please contact the accommodation team to discuss available options.
International students aged under 18
International students aged under 18
Due to the requirements of the Education (Pastoral Care of Tertiary and International Learners) Code of Practice, Massey Halls is unable to accommodate international students who are under 18 years of age.
We instead recommend homestay accommodation, which provides an appropriate level of support and supervision for younger students transitioning to studying and living in New Zealand.
Once you turn 18, you are welcome to apply for accommodation at Massey Halls.
